Apricot
Apricot is a warm and soft color that is reminiscent of the fruit of the same name. It is a light orange color with hints of pink and peach. Apricot is often associated with warmth, comfort, and happiness. In terms of paint colors, apricot can be created by mixing various shades of orange, yellow, and white.
Russet
Russet is a deep and earthy color that is similar to the color of rust or copper. It is a reddish-brown color with hints of orange and purple. Russet is often associated with strength, stability, and sophistication. In terms of paint colors, russet can be created by mixing various shades of red, brown, and orange.

Paint Colors vs. RGB Colors
It is important to note the difference between paint colors and RGB (Red, Green, Blue) colors. Paint colors are physical colors that are created by mixing different pigments together. RGB colors, on the other hand, are digital colors that are created by mixing different amounts of red, green, and blue light together.
